Ganderbal: Anganwadi workers, helpers protests, demand regularization

Ganderbal: Anganwadi workers and helpers of  here protested and blocked Beehama safapora road near mini secretariat demanding regularization of services and enhancement of salaries.
Police reached on spot and asked protesting Anganwadi workers open the blocked road. However the protesting Anganwadi workers refused to disperse and continued their protest.
Police swung into action and used batons and teargas shells to disperse the protesters.
SHO ganderbal Nisar Hurrah said that the Anganwadi workers disrupted traffic on highway and did not move from road despite repeated pleas.
